About this property
Boasting spacious indoor and outdoor hot spring baths surrounded by lush greenery, Ryokan Wakaba provides Japanese-style accommodations in the peaceful mountain area. Free Wi-Fi is offered in the public area, and parking is available for free. Featuring a relaxing ambiance, each room comes with a comfortable seating area with a low table and seating cushions. Some rooms are fitted with traditional futon bedding, while others have Western beds. A TV and a fridge are included. Guests at Wakaba Ryokan can experience rejuvenating stone sauna. The spacious indoor hot spring baths feature retro décor, and smaller baths can be reserved for private use. JR Kumamoto Station is about a 100-minute drive away, and Aso Shrine is a 40-minute drive from the property. Guests with a dinner-inclusive rate can savor Japanese-style full-course dinner with delicately prepared seasonal dishes. Alternatively, guests can choose to add half-course dinner to their breakfast-inclusive rate booking.

The fine print
Dinner for the dinner-inclusive rate is a Japanese-style full-course meal with 12 dishes including roasted beef as the main dish. Guests who prefer to have horse sashimi instead of roasted beef must contact the property at least 1 day prior to the check-in date.
Please note that if dinner is requested on the day of check-in, a half-course meal with 8 dishes will be served.
Guests with food allergies and/or dietary restrictions must inform the property at the time of booking. Please note that the property may not be able to accommodate meal requests without advance notice.
Guests with children must inform the property at time of booking. Please specify how many children will be staying and their respective ages in the special request box.
Please inform Ryokan Wakaba of your expected arrival time in advance. You can use the Special Requests box when booking, or contact the property directly using the contact details in your confirmation.
Guests must check in by 20:30:00 to eat dinner at this property. Guests who check in after this time may not be served dinner, and no refund will be given.
